2026-05-15 03:38:42
在我们深入探讨区块链工程的课程之前,咱们先来聊聊区块链是什么吧。简单来说,区块链是一种去中心化的网络技术,它让数据能够在多个地方存储,同时又保证了这些数据的安全性和不可篡改性。想象一下,如果你在一个大派对上,大家都在讨论同样的话题,但没有一个人是“领头羊”,每个人都能为这个话题添加自己的看法,不容易变成谣言吧?这就像区块链,大家都在一起共同管理信息。这项技术近年来在金融、供应链、医疗等领域都引起了巨大的反响,吸引了很多人的注意。
那么,既然区块链技术这么火,学习区块链工程的课程自然也会变得多种多样。不过,整体来看,区块链工程的课程大概可以分为以下几个主要模块:
首先,你得对区块链有个基础的了解。这一部分的课程通常会涵盖区块链的基本概念、架构、运作原理以及一些相关的技术术语,比如“智能合约”、“共识机制”等等。想象一下,如果你打算在一个陌生的城市旅游,你肯定得先了解这个城市的地图、交通和哪些地方好玩吧?区块链也类似,只有理解了它的基础,才能更好地深入。
再来,我们不得不提到的是区块链安全性。数据放到网上,总要有点东西来保护它对吧?这就是加密算法的作用。这部分课程会教你关于公钥和私钥的概念,如何进行数字签名,如何使用哈希函数等等,这些都是确保区块链信息不可篡改的关键。此外,还有很多关于网络安全的小知识。这段学习过程可能会让不熟悉技术的小伙伴有点头疼,但别担心,就把它看成是学习密码学的小乐趣。
接下来,咱们要动手啦!这一阶段会涉及一些具体的编程语言,比如Solidity、Python等,特别是Solidity,它是以太坊上智能合约的主要语言。简单来说,你得学会怎么编写智能合约、如何应用区块链平台、如何进行链上链下的数据交互等等。记得我第一次写智能合约的时候,感觉就像在学外国人发音,时而能读出来,时而就叫个莫名其妙,先别怕,我后来发现,慢慢来就行,一步一步积累经验。
拉拉杂杂讲了这么多,接下来的部分就更有趣啦!在这一阶段,你会参与一些项目实战。可能是团队合作完成一个小型区块链项目,或是参加一些黑客松(hackathon),尝试用区块链解决现实生活中的问题。这就像你决定开车去旅行,总得有几个练手的机会,让你熟悉驾驭的感觉,对吧?在这个过程中,不仅能够巩固你对前面所学知识的理解,还能培养你的团队协作能力和快速解决问题的能力,特别重要哦!
最后,当然不能忘了讨论区块链的应用场景,和它在产业中的发展趋势。这一块的内容会涉及到区块链在金融、物流、医疗、版权保护等多个行业的实际应用。通过学习,可以了解到不同企业是怎样应用这一技术的,很多时候理解行业需求与市场动态,可以帮助你更好地把握未来的职业发展方向。现在其实很多互联网巨头公司也在布局区块链相关业务,有了这个思维,未来找工作或创业时,你会更具优势。
说到这儿,学习区块链工程显示得越来越重要,不仅因为它是一个热门的行业方向,更因为它展现了未来科技的发展趋势。如果你对这些内容感兴趣,不妨开始一段属于你的学习之旅。记得,每个领域都有它独特的挑战和机会,选择了,就得全力以赴!当然,不同的教育机构可能课程设置会有所不同,但总体方向都是围绕以上关键词展开。希望这些内容对你能有所帮助,有兴致的一起加油,未来也许我们可以在这个领域相遇,碰撞出不一样的火花!